Elegen VS DNA Script

DNA Script is perceived as one of Elegen's biggest rivals. DNA Script was founded in 2014, and is headquartered in Le Kremlin-Bicetre, Île-de-France. Like Elegen, DNA Script also competes in the Pharmaceuticals & Biotechnology space. DNA Script generates $31.9M more revenue vs. Elegen.

Elegen VS Twist Bioscience

Twist Bioscience is a top competitor of Elegen. Twist Bioscience is a Public company that was founded in 2013 in South San Francisco, California. Like Elegen, Twist Bioscience also works within the Pharmaceuticals & Biotechnology sector. Compared to Elegen, Twist Bioscience has 970 more employees.

Elegen VS Ribbon Biolabs

Ribbon Biolabs is Elegen's #3 rival. Ribbon Biolabs is headquartered in Vienna, Vienna, and was founded in 2018. Ribbon Biolabs operates in the Biotechnology industry. Ribbon Biolabs generates 100% the revenue of Elegen.
